Row-Level Security from inside the Electricity BI: Area 1 – Jobs and you will Users

Row-Level Security from inside the Electricity BI: Area 1 – Jobs and you will Users

What if the newest Financing Agency off a clothing retailer has some higher account that allow her or him select all the transformation along side You; so excellent, in fact, that they want to show these with all Local Executives thus they could show about the gorgeous locations inside their part. The problem is a nearby Managers aren’t permitted to discover investigation external their region, and you may providing them with accessibility such reports allows them to filter to the part it need. We are able to carry out separate Datasets and you will reports blocked into the part towards the manager that’s provided access to her or him, but that might be time-taking, and you may a headache to steadfastly keep up. Luckily for us, Fuel BI has the capability to incorporate Line-Height Cover (RLS).

So, what is actually RLS? This basically means, they control an excellent user’s accessibility each individual line of your Dataset. From inside the Energy BI they do this filtering the info during the DAX according to research by the member. Throughout the example below, we are able to get a hold of Billy asking for a listing of most of the claims; Electricity BI after that fits Billy to his jobs and you may strain the brand new claims down seriously to the ones within his jobs.

Usually, in the Electricity BI, simple fact is that that side of a love one filter systems down the numerous corners (the same way you to definitely state filters geography) however,, in regards to our aim we require the official Member with the purpose to help you filter out the fresh new claims

From the declaration, we may has a webpage that presents conversion process analysis because of the location, and we need the Local Movie director to simply see the conversion study in the region.

When you look at the Energy BI, RLS is defined inside Power BI Desktop courtesy roles; jobs define DAX strain to have whatever tables he could be designed to secure. This is why we should instead be mindful toward build of your Investigation Design so as that our company is filtering towards the highest-height entity you can. Regarding analogy lower than, we see good Dataset just like the situation above and you may good report that they drives.

Notice the relationship between County User and you will Condition; County Representative will have many profiles which will be able to see the same condition, therefore, this might be a one-to-of many dating, as well as in it including, the state Pages are definitely the many

Now that we have the appropriate design set-up into the study in order to filter because of the area, we need to create our spots. When you look at the Power BI Pc this can be done when you go to Modeling > Perform Jobs, we can then would the fresh new positions in this take on the new remaining and you may identify their dining table strain on the https://datingranking.net/nl/senior-match-overzicht/ right.

Now that you will find one or two Spots arranged, we could play with Strength BI to evaluate them aside with the Consider as the Roles button near the Carry out Roles option.

Statement due to the fact some body into the Mountain Role perform see it (Note the latest pub at the top denoting the fresh Jobs that individuals was watching brand new Declaration since)

Also securing off usage of tables having difficult-coded filter systems, we could together with leverage safety which is built into the knowledge. Imagine if we try sourcing these records regarding a software that handles security within the database of the giving owner’s accessibility specific claims. In this instance, we are able to entice so it safety suggestions and use this type of relationships to filter out analysis from the who is seeing the fresh statement. Below, we can pick these Safety Dining tables brought for the Fuel BI; the user Dining table (greyed aside as we have been covering up it regarding the last declaration) filters the state Member Desk to a variety of the user that is logged when you look at the additionally the country’s data he or she is let observe. This desk subsequent filter systems the state Dining table, which then filter systems the brand new Geography Dining table.

To achieve this, we should instead make dating filter out in guidelines and apply the security filter both in instructions.

Given that the info Model is set up, we have to do a role in fact it is able to filter out by signed when you look at the user’s label. To achieve this, we are able to manage a job you to definitely filter systems an individual with the DAX setting USERPRINCIPALNAME(); to not ever getting mistaken for Username() that can be the fresh new Website name\Sign on (According to your Post,) the fresh USERPRINCIPALNAME() productivity the brand new user’s current email address.

Nowadays, you aren’t which part applied will have the user Dining table filtered by the their current email address and you will then, will receive all of those other tables down-the-line. To test so it, we will see so you can describe exactly who we have been log in because observe new statement they will certainly see.

Since all of us have of our own roles authored we are going to need to assign them to the appropriate pages. We need to publish a beneficial PBIX in order to a workspace for the the benefit BI Services; next i go to Datasets > [Our Dataset having RLS] > … > Coverage. Right here we can assign users to help you spots; i get the role we want to increase and commence entering, Electricity BI can filter by email address otherwise term within your providers. Remember that anyone that isn’t an admin seeing a research they’ve no roles allotted to, however, that uses RLS will not be able so you can stream any pictures.

These Defense Spots could well be used on anyone viewing the report in a released Stamina BI App, and you will transform towards cover will not require app to getting had written once again. Such positions might affect anyone who is actually a member of new Workspace; so long as the fresh Workplace is established to let participants in order to simply take a look at blogs and not modify.

Tune in having Row-Level Safeguards within the Electricity BI: Part dos RLS inside Stuck Profile; in which we’re going to go over handling RLS to you records inserted on your inner and you may buyers-against Programs.

Go ahead and begin a conversation less than or head to our very own BI team’s web page for additional info on exactly how Tallan will help your organization get the maximum benefit out of Fuel BI as well as your current research structure.

0161 413 8763

7 days a week from 8am - 9pm

Thinking of joining our panel? Get in touch with customer acquisition agency, mmadigital, by completing their contact form and they will get back to you. Digital Agency